Obituary of John Edgar Ahlbrand
John E. Ahlbrand, 92, of Columbus died Wednesday January 8, 2020 2:20 a.m. at Our Hospice Inpatient Facility. John was born July 23, 1927 in Columbus, the son of Martin H. and Mamie Rousch Ahlbrand, He married Carole E. Parker December 16, 1950 in Columbus; she survives. The graduated from Columbus High School in 1944 entering the Army Air Force as an air cadet from 1944-1945. He continued as an aircraft and engine mechanic until 1946. He attended Purdue University 1947-1953 graduating with a degree in Mechanical Engineering. After graduation he worked for Cummins in sales, moving to the New York office in 1958. He left Cummins in 1961 becoming Vice-president of Sales for Silent Hoist and Crane in Brooklyn, NY. He lived in Merrick, NY on Long Island, returning to Columbus in 2007 after retiring from S.H. & C. While living on Long Island, he enjoyed Jones Beach and the theatre in Manhattan. He traveled to Europe often, Italy being his favorite. He was an avid stamp collector, interested in aviation and a member of The Columbus Area Railroad Club.
